Software Engineer Data Analytics

Year    India, India

Job Description


PubMatic (Nasdaq: PUBM) is an independent technology company maximizing customer value by delivering digital advertising\'s supply chain of the future. PubMatic\'s sell-side platform empowers the world\'s leading digital content creators across the open internet to control access to their inventory and increase monetization by enabling marketers to drive return on investment and reach addressable audiences across ad formats and devices. Since 2006, our infrastructure-driven approach has allowed for the efficient processing and utilization of data in real time. By delivering scalable and flexible programmatic innovation, we improve outcomes for our customers while championing a vibrant and transparent digital advertising supply chain. Build, design and implement our highly scalable, fault-tolerant, highly available big data platform to processterabytesof dataand provide customers with in-depth analytics. DevelopingBig Datapipelines using modern technology stack such asSpark, Hadoop, Kafka, HBase, Hive, Presto etc. Developinganalyticsapplications ground up using modern technology stack such asJava, Spring, Tomcat, Jenkins, REST APIs,JDBC, Amazon Web Services, Hibernate. Building data pipelinetoautomate high-volumedatacollection and processing to providereal-time data analytics. Customize PubMatic\'sreporting and analyticsplatformbased on customer\'srequirementsfrom customers and deliverscalable, production-ready solutions. Lead multiple projects todevelop features for data processing and reporting platform, collaborate with product managers, cross-functional teams, other stakeholders and ensure successful delivery of projects. Use various mechanisms established tofetch data fromdifferent external data sourcesand reconcilethemwith PubMatic\'sprocessed data. Collaborate with functional teams to build products todeliver end-to-end products and features and fix bugs for better performance. Develop robust& fault-tolerantsystemsandmonitor implications of changesondata processing pipeline and performance. Leveraginga broad range of PubMatic\'s data architecture strategies and proposing both data flows and storage solutions. Managing Hadoop map reduce and spark jobs&solving any ongoing issues with operating the cluster. Working closely with cross functional teams onimproving availability and scalability oflargedata platform and functionality of PubMatic software. Expertisein developingImplementation of professionalsoftwareengineering best practices for the fullsoftwaredevelopment life cycle, including coding standards, performing code reviews, committing to GitHub, preparing documents in Confluence, continuous delivery using Jenkins, automated testing, and operations. Participate inAgile/Scrum processessuch as sprint planning, sprint retrospective, backlog grooming, user story management, work item prioritization, etc. Frequently discuss with product managers about the software features to include in PubMatic Data Analytics platform. Understand the technical aspects customer requirement from product managers. Keep in regular touch withqualityengineeringteam whichensurethe quality of the platforms/products and performance SLAsof java based micro services and spark-based data pipeline. Support customer issuesover emailorJIRA (bug tracking system),provide updates, patches to customers to fix the issues. Discuss with technical writing teamabout the technical documents that are publishedon documentation portal. Perform codeand design reviews for code implemented by peers or as per the code review process. Qualifications 1 to 4 years coding experience in Java. Solidcomputer sciencefundamentals including data structureand algorithm design, and creation of architectural specifications. Expertise in developing Implementation of professional software engineering best practices for the full software development life cycle, including coding standards, code reviews, source control management, documentation, build processes, automated testing, and operations. A passion for developing and maintaining a high-quality code and test base and enabling contributions from engineers across the team. Expertise in big data technologies like Hadoop, Spark, Kafka, HBase etc would be an added advantage. Experience in developing and delivering large-scale big-data pipelines, real-time systems & data warehouses would be preferred. Demonstrated ability to achieve stretch goals in a very innovative and fast paced environment. Demonstrated ability to learn new technologies quickly and independently. Excellent verbal and written communication skills, especially in technical communications. Strong interpersonal skills and a desire to work collaboratively. #LI-MD1 Additional Information Return to Office : PubMatic employees throughout the global have returned to our offices via a hybrid work schedule (3 days \'in office\' and 2 days \'working remotely\') that is intended to maximize collaboration, innovation, and productivity among teams and across functions. All PubMatic employees in the US and India are required to be fully vaccinated to return to our offices. Covid-19 boosters are not required at this point in time. Benefits : Our benefits package includes the best of what leading organizations provide, such as stock options, paternity/maternity leave, healthcare insurance, broadband reimbursement. As well, when we\'re back in the office, we all benefit from a kitchen loaded with healthy snacks and drinks and catered lunches and much more! Diversity and Inclusion : PubMatic is proud to be an equal opportunity employer we don\'t just value diversity, we promote and celebrate it.We do not discriminate on the basis of race, religion, color, national origin, gender, sexual orientation, age, marital status, veteran status, or disability status.

foundit

Beware of fraud agents! do not pay money to get a job

MNCJobsIndia.com will not be responsible for any payment made to a third-party. All Terms of Use are applicable.


Related Jobs

Job Detail

  • Job Id
    JD3094286
  • Industry
    Not mentioned
  • Total Positions
    1
  • Job Type:
    Full Time
  • Salary:
    Not mentioned
  • Employment Status
    Permanent
  • Job Location
    India, India
  • Education
    Not mentioned
  • Experience
    Year